Handover: Korvid SDK parity (from Desh to next owner). Swift client is ahead of the Kotlin one by three features: batched uploads, offline queue flush, and retry jitter. Kotlin port is half-done on branch parity-q3. Do not ship Kotlin 4.2 until offline queue lands — partners test against both. Parity matrix is kept current by CI; failures mean the table is stale, not broken. Chask owns the Swift side. Full parity checklist lives on the internal page here.

operations page: https://confluence.qorvellabs.internal/pages/projects/projects/projects

**Vendor Note: Pellwright PDF Invoice Renderer**

Pellwright renders invoices in an isolated sandbox with no outbound network access; templates are signed and verified at load. Their latest assessment covered font parsing and embedded-script handling, both rated low risk. Full audit reports are available on request. Security questions about the renderer should be directed to their compliance desk.

escalation mailbox, bafog-fafog: ulador@paliqlabs.internal

Runbook: turning on telemetry compression (Pulsegrove collector). Quick context — raw payloads from the field units were chewing through our ingest budget, so we're enabling zstd framing at the edge. Roll it out region by region; the collector auto-detects compressed frames, so mixed fleets are fine during the window. Watch the decode-error gauge for ten minutes after each region flips — anything above a trickle means roll back that region. The edge agents should be restarted with the configuration values given below.

service settings:
[casax]
port = 6379
team = rusir
host = casax.zemvarhq.corp
region = outer-4
access_code = ac_9808ce
timeout_ms = 1500

Welcome to on-call for Gridleaf! The CSV import wizard in Tallyhook occasionally wedges on malformed headers — just restart the parser pod and re-run the job. If the wizard's config store locks itself after three failed restarts, you'll need to unlock it manually from the admin shell. The passphrase you'll need for that unlock is below.

vault phrase of bagaf-kajeg = jorath-feniel-briir-siliel-ralix